Stainless steel hoof nails provide superior corrosion resistance for wet or coastal environments and for horses with metal sensitivities. Often chosen for longevity, rust-free appearance, and reduced staining of hooves, stainless nails are appealing to farriers, trainers, and owners who want a durable, low-maintenance fastening solution. In Canada, where coastal humidity, salted roads, and year-round turnout can accelerate corrosion, buyers prioritize alloy grade, nail geometry, clinchability, and compatibility with common horseshoe steels. Farriers tend to favor products that balance holding power with predictable clinch behavior, a consistent head and shank profile for fast work, and availability in the box sizes and lengths used regionally. Price, local distribution, and brand reputation also shape preferences, with many professionals opting for proven lines that reduce rework and maintain hoof appearance over the shoeing cycle.

What Research and Testing Say About Stainless Hoof Nails

Laboratory corrosion tests, field reports from farriers, and materials science research help explain why stainless steel is widely used for hoof nails. Key findings cover alloy selection, surface behavior, and compatibility with horseshoes and environment. The practical benefits reported by professionals include reduced rust staining, longer service life of the fastener, and fewer finish problems at clinches. The scientific principles below are explained in plain language so farriers and horse owners can make informed choices.

Corrosion resistance: Standard corrosion testing such as salt spray and immersion studies show that chromium-containing stainless alloys form a passive oxide layer on the surface that greatly slows rust compared with carbon steel. In coastal and winter-salt environments common in Canada this reduces visible staining and nail degradation.

Alloy differences matter: Austenitic grades such as 304 stainless are commonly used for fasteners, while 316 stainless contains molybdenum for improved resistance to chloride-driven corrosion. For extreme coastal exposure, higher chloride resistance helps nail longevity.

Biocompatibility and staining: Reduced surface oxidation of stainless decreases iron transfer to the hoof and hair, which lowers the risk of unsightly rust streaks. Some veterinarians and farriers also report fewer local skin or hoof reactions where metal sensitivity is suspected, but confirmed allergies are relatively uncommon and case dependent.

Galvanic compatibility: Metals in contact with each other can undergo galvanic corrosion in the presence of electrolytes such as salty water. Using stainless nails with stainless shoes or ensuring compatible pairings reduces the chance of accelerated corrosion of either component.

Clinch behavior and mechanical performance: Controlled studies and farrier trials emphasize consistent head geometry and shank profile to produce predictable clinching. Nail designs that favor easy clinch formation reduce hoof trauma and rework during shoeing cycles.
